ga naar Readme met nieuwste ontiwkkelingen

we love web

Vasilis van Gemert

Vasilis van Gemert is een principal frontender en vakdocent CMD. Zijn LinkedIn-profiel vind je hier. Vroeger was hij een kunstenaar. Het nut van onzin maken is dat je er inspiratie uit kunt halen. Voorbeelden hiervan staan op zijn website vasilis.nl.

Voor zijn masteropdracht heeft hij een pagina gemaakt en ingeleverd, die je kunt bekijken op deze link. Gebruik je creativiteit en maak gekke dingen; daar kun je veel van leren. Maak een website niet alleen toegankelijk in theorie, maar ook in de praktijk, zodat deze echt bruikbaar is en je niet achteraf problemen ontdekt. Screenreaders kunnen ingewikkeld zijn als je ze nog niet kent. Een gebruiker hoort bijvoorbeeld “heading 2”, wat verwarrend kan zijn. Test altijd zelf de website die je maakt met een screenreader, zodat je weet hoe het voor anderen is.

Nicolas Garnier

is een onafhankelijk creatief developer die zich sinds 2012 focust op webontwikkeling met JavaScript, nadat Flash is verdwenen. Hij begon in 2018 met freelancen en werkte voor bureaus, productbedrijven en startups.

  • Hij bouwt websites, apps, installaties en gebruikt daarbij diverse tools zoals JavaScript, CSS, WebGL en Unity.
  • Zijn doel is om met alle beschikbare technologieën creatieve en technische uitdagingen op te lossen.
  • De kern van zijn werk bestaat uit code, design, motion en interactiviteit.

gebruik van animatie

  • je website word mooier en het zorgt dat mensen langer op de website zijn
  • een animatie moet funcitoneel zijn en kan niet stuk zijn
  • niet iedereen houd van animaties

links met websites

Dion Pieters

Hij is creative developer en docent bij onze opleiding

  • Hij heeft informatie gestudeerd en bij cmd ook heeft die dviser bedrijven gewerkt zoals spotify active collective build in amsterdam
  • in het gastcollege heeft hij vertelt over een portfolio en dat je diverse vragen moet stellen om rekening te houden met de eindgebruikers en potentiele odprachtgevers vragen kunnen onder andere zijn wie kijkt naar je portfolio en wat wil je overbrengen met je portfolio en is het noodzakelijk om er een te hebben.
  • Tijdens het bouwen moet je de vanuit meerdere invallen bekijken want als je gaat designen meot je rekning houden met de gebruiker waardoor je dus ook niet volledig je creativiteit kan uiten odmat je ook weer denkt dat iet sniet kan
  • animaties is iets dat moet je erin hebben om de aandacht van de gebruiker te kunnen vasthouden en om je website er ebter uit te laten zien

Emiel van Betsbrugge

WebGL Developer bij Active Theory

  • Hij komt uit kortrijk ook heeft die 8 jaar ervaring als developer en dit is zijn website

hij heeft vertelt over pitchen hoe je een presenatie geeft en hoe je jouw product naar productie kan omzetten en daarin komen deze stappen

  • Pitch
  • Discovery
  • Design & Early dev
  • Development
  • QA
  • Go Live
  • Retrospect
  • ive

pitch dat is wie wat wanneer en hoe

welke mensen zijn er en de details wat krijg je en wat is optioneel

discovery de ontdekkingsfase wat willen we precies gaan maken en heo gaan we dit aanpakken

Design & Early dev het project opstarten een sprint planning maken en iteren en prioriteiten steleln

development het bouwen en het fixen van bugs en ook testen werkt alles naar behoren en op de details letten

QA Quality Assuring de laatste fase van het testen waarin gechekt word of alles echt werkt en of er niet nog onverwachte bugs zijn

go live: het livezetten van je product

retrospective het terugkijken is het goedgegaan en hoe gaan we verder

de belangrijkste aantekningen:kwaliteit bovne kwaniteit en maak plezier doe iets wat je echt leuk vind en de performance is ook van belang

dave bitter

persoonlijke website: zijn persoonlijke website presiparrot een website die hij gemaakt heeft een audiowebAPI ook wel speechregnotion het is sinds 1950 en het werd steeds verberterd in 2000 begon google en in 2010 begonnen de smartassisent the magic ai black box en mensen gebruiken chatgot im te zoeken in plaats van alleen zoeken op google hij zegt iets en de ai die luistert en er zitten 4 hoofdelen in speechregonisiton chatgpt en daarna speechsynthethis

using the speechregoniztion webapi using the speechsynthethis webap for our output https://www.davebitter.com/articles/interacting-with-chat-gpt-through-voice-ui-on-the-web hier staat de demo op

the select role by the user the personality of ai

elevenlabs is gratis om te gebruikten en je haalt alle audio data af en je speelt de audio data performance over anything and nothing breaks the illusion than the high latency ai is just another data sourche its the ux that makes the difference hoe is het leuk en functioneel en don't forget about the older techniques make cool stuff build,dont just discuss

cassie evans

cassie evans different ways such as vanilla ui animations the gsap library is big it is extensive and it uses method and targets and also vars no position direction sequences they use scroll positions gsap is something like a toolbox of everything that you need quicksetter is a utility cursor followers codepen gsap utils utils.random utils.maprange utils.wrap utils.pipe() voor animations

the ease do the work it is very important you can use a glitcy animation with the ease visualizer you can see the code that you need with matchmedia you can change the animation when it has a specific screen for example pointer events or hovers with user preferences reduce motion you can change the animation for people who turn off the animation

control methods skipp to a certain point you can animate the timeline with a ease when you click on something helper functions in gsap

container animation it moves the contianer so it is a animation in a other animation motionpath intern en exit animations in gap you use timelines